Abstract (en)

The invention is related to a spray nozzle (20, 30) for spraying fluids in droplets for processing fibrous webs. The nozzle comprises a housing having a first longitudinal central channel (24, 34) for the fluid to be sprayed and a second coaxially extending outer channel (21, 31) for a dispersing fluid. The velocity vector of the fluid to be sprayed exiting from the opening of the first channel has mainly a linear component, that is the fluid exiting from the nozzle has essentially rectilinear motion, whereas the velocity vector (V1, V2) of the dispersing fluid exiting from the opening of the second channel has both rotational and linear components, that is the dispersing fluid exiting from the nozzle has spiral motion. The nozzle (20, 30 is provided with means (25, 35) for feeding the dispersing fluid tangentially at the infeed end of the second channel (21, 31), the second channel having inner (22, 32) and outer walls (23, 33) defining an annular space therebetween. The space is dimensioned (±, ², D1, D2, H1, H2) such that the rate between the rotational and linear components of the velocity (V1, V2) of the dispersing fluid increases before it leaves the channel (21, 31) and contacts the fluid to be sprayed. The invention is related also to a method for spraying fluids in droplets for processing fibrous webs.
